Mesa Verde set to reopen after fire
Facebook Twitter Email
MONDAY, AUGUST 5, 2002

A fire at Mesa Verde National Park in Colorado was 80 percent contained as of Sunday.

The 2,600-acre blaze has threatened some of the park's historic Puebloan structures. But they mostly escaped any harm.

Parts of the park are set to reopen later this week.
